Transaction 574921c4a807554fd631037ce23b10c232c35feccd288ed8a2884461e8ecb847

2 Input
2 Outputs
  • 574921c4a807554fd631037ce23b10c232c35feccd288ed8a2884461e8ecb847:0
  • value  679456
    address  3Dwkeo3xKdKjgHEpTfJZvujJqsyBL4CdMi
  • 574921c4a807554fd631037ce23b10c232c35feccd288ed8a2884461e8ecb847:1
  • value  755875
    address  178rStoWxvKtoYfwbzw9aKENWgHSAjS6LF